Ok this might be just my noobnes but here goes. How do you get this mod to work in campaing/tutorial battles... Or is this even possible?? Works fine in sandbox battles... And its awesome and disgusting all at the same time :laugh:
Mods cannot be played with stock Gettysburg scenarios. However, the scenarios can be renamed for this purpose. The following mod serves this purpose quite well except carryover scenarios are eliminated:

I've downloaded the folder, and copied the folder "Latest Historical Scenarios 1.4" into the Mod game folder, but the mod doesn't show up in the mod list in-game.
I see the prob right off--Mod names can't have periods (.) Delete the period in 1.4 and you should be good to go.

For future downloads of this GB stock scenarios mod, this issue has been fixed...RENAMED.
